Not Eating Or Drinking At End Of Life. During the last weeks, days or hours of life, it's normal for people to eat and drink less than usual or not at all. For most individuals, this period lasts about 10 days, although. Hospice patients can live for varying lengths of time without eating, typically ranging from a few days to several weeks. Not wanting to eat or drink. People need less fuel when they're. Not wanting to eat is common in people who are dying. People also don’t need to eat and drink as much. You may also find it difficult to swallow medicine. In the last stage of life, many people lose their desire to eat or drink. Near the end of life, it's normal to experience loss of appetite and reduced thirst.
